They made five 3-color dragons for this Core Set...
You don't quite understand what colors are for then.
PWs in Core Sets bear the responsibility to give new players the flavor and philosophy of each single color, it's the strongest tool WotC has and they're not going to change their mind anytime soon.
Core Sets are still designed for new players and not meant to introduce a new story (it usually tells / refers to the past though). Multicolored PWs tell via their color shift a change in their philosophy, a strong event in their storyline.
Multicolored creatures show off guilds (2 or 3 colors), it's a completely different role.
Nicol Bolas is already a pretty stunning move, it's a creature but turns into a multicolored PW. It's a unique case of the mix between the return of elder dragons + the fact Bolas has turned into a PW a while ago + Origins has been successful at making flipwalkers in order to tell their story.
